How to Perfect Pumpkin Coffee Cake

To ensure your pumpkin coffee cake turns out perfectly every time, keep these tips in mind.

  •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Make sure eggs, sour cream, and any other dairy are at room temperature for better mixing and texture.
  • Measure Flour Correctly: Spoon flour into your measuring cup and level off to avoid using too much, which can make the cake dense.
  • Don’t Overmix the Batter: Mix until just combined. Overmixing can lead to a tougher texture in your cake.
  • Check Doneness with a Toothpick: Insert a toothpick into the center; if it comes out clean or with just a few crumbs, it’s done baking.
  • Let It Cool Completely: Allow the cake to cool fully before frosting or serving. This helps maintain its structure.
  • Store Properly: Keep any leftovers covered at room temperature for up to three days or refrigerate for longer freshness.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store leftover pumpkin coffee cake in an airtight container.
  • It will last up to 5 days in the refrigerator.

Freezing Pumpkin Coffee Cake

  • Wrap slices t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il.
  • Store in a freezer-safe container or zip-top bag for up to 3 months.

Reheating Pumpkin Coffee Cake

  • Oven: Preheat to 350F (175C). Place slices on a baking sheet, cover with foil, and heat for about 10-15 minutes.
  • Microwave: Heat individual slices on a microwave-safe plate for 15-30 seconds, checking until warm.
  • Stovetop: Use a skillet over low heat. Cover with a lid and warm for about 5 minutes, flipping halfway through.

Frequently Asked Questions

Here are some common questions about making pumpkin coffee cake that can help clarify any doubts you may have.

How do I make my Pumpkin Coffee Cake more moist?

To enhance moisture, ensure you’re using room temperature ingredients like eggs and sour cream. Adding extra canned pumpkin can also help maintain moisture levels.

Can I use fresh pumpkin instead of canned?

Yes! If you prefer fresh pumpkin, roast it first until tender, then puree it before adding it to the batter.

What can I substitute for sour cream in Pumpkin Coffee Cake?

Greek yogurt is an excellent substitute for sour cream. You can also use buttermilk or a dairy-free yogurt if you prefer.

How do I know when my Pumpkin Coffee Cake is done?

The cake is done when a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or with just a few crumbs attached.
